Reading a cannabis lab report can feel like staring at a chemistry exam you never studied for. You see rows of numbers for THC, CBD, and terpenes, but making sense of the percentages takes a little know-how. The good news is the math is straightforward once you know which numbers to use. To calculate terpene percentage from lab results, divide the total weight of all terpenes by the total weight of the sample, then multiply by 100. Most lab reports already list each terpene as a percentage, so you simply add those individual percentages together to get the total terpene percentage.

What Does a Terpene Percentage Actually Tell You?

A terpene percentage tells you how much of the plant’s total weight is made up of aromatic compounds. These are the molecules responsible for the smell and flavor of cannabis, like pinene in pine trees or limonene in citrus. Beyond aroma, terpenes interact with cannabinoids like THC and CBD, and some research suggests this combination affects the overall experience.

Most lab reports show each terpene individually. You might see myrcene at 0.5%, limonene at 0.3%, and caryophyllene at 0.2%. To find the total terpene percentage, add all of those individual numbers together. In that example, the total would be 1.0%.

The total terpene content in most cannabis flower falls between 0.5% and 3%. Anything above 2% is generally considered high in terpenes. Concentrates and extracts often have much higher percentages because the extraction process removes plant material and concentrates the aromatic compounds.

How To Calculate Terpene Percentage From Lab Results Step by Step

Follow these steps to calculate the total terpene percentage from any lab report:

  • Find the section of the report labeled “Terpenes” or “Terpene Profile.”
  • Identify each individual terpene listed and its percentage value.
  • Add all the individual percentages together.
  • The sum is your total terpene percentage.

For example, if a report lists myrcene 0.4%, caryophyllene 0.3%, limonene 0.2%, and humulene 0.1%, the total terpene percentage is 1.0%.

Some labs report terpenes in milligrams per gram (mg/g) instead of percentages. If that is the case, convert each value to a percentage first by dividing by 10. One mg/g equals 0.1%. So 10 mg/g would be 1.0%.

Why Terpene Percentages Vary Between Lab Reports

Terpene percentages are not fixed numbers. They change based on the plant’s genetics, growing conditions, harvest timing, and how the sample was stored. A strain tested at one lab may show different terpene percentages than the same strain tested at another lab.

Testing methods also differ between laboratories. Some labs use gas chromatography, while others use high-performance liquid chromatography. Each method can produce slightly different results. The sample itself matters too — a sample from the top of the plant may have more terpenes than one taken from lower branches.

Because of these variables, treat lab results as a snapshot rather than an absolute truth. The percentages give you a useful idea of the terpene profile, but small differences between labs do not mean one report is wrong.

Understanding the Difference Between Weight and Percentage

Terpene percentage is always a weight-based measurement. The lab weighs the total sample, then weighs the terpenes extracted from that sample. The percentage represents the terpene weight divided by the total sample weight.

This matters because moisture content affects the calculation. Fresh cannabis contains more water, which dilutes the terpene percentage. Dried cannabis has less water, so the same amount of terpenes will show up as a higher percentage.

Labs typically test dried flower, but the exact moisture level can vary. This is one reason the same strain might show slightly different terpene percentages on different lab reports. The terpene content did not change — the water content did.

What Is a Good Terpene Percentage?

There is no single “good” terpene percentage because it depends on the product type and personal preference. For flower, a total terpene percentage of 1% to 2% is common. Premium flower often tests above 2%. Some exceptional batches reach 3% or higher.

Concentrates tell a different story. Live resin and rosin often test between 5% and 15% total terpenes. Some high-terpene extracts exceed 15%. These products are more potent in aroma and flavor because the extraction process concentrates terpenes along with cannabinoids.

Higher terpene percentages do not automatically mean better quality. A balanced profile with several terpenes may provide a more complex experience than a product with one dominant terpene. Pay attention to the full profile rather than chasing a single high number.

How Accurate Are Lab Terpene Measurements?

Laboratory testing for terpenes is reasonably accurate but not perfect. Accredited labs follow strict protocols and use calibrated equipment. However, terpenes are volatile compounds — they evaporate easily. Sample handling, storage temperature, and the time between harvest and testing all affect the final numbers.

Some research suggests that terpene levels can decrease significantly during storage, especially if the product is exposed to heat or light. A lab result reflects the terpene content at the time of testing, not necessarily what you will experience weeks later when you open the package.

If you are comparing products, look for lab reports from the same laboratory. This reduces the variability caused by different testing methods. Comparing reports across different labs can be misleading because each lab has its own protocols and tolerances.

Terpenes vs. Cannabinoids: Two Different Measurements

Lab reports list cannabinoids like THC and CBD separately from terpenes. These are different classes of compounds measured using different methods. Cannabinoid percentages are typically much higher than terpene percentages. THC levels in flower commonly range from 15% to 30%, while terpenes rarely exceed 3%.

Do not confuse the two sections on a lab report. Adding THC percentage to terpene percentage gives you a meaningless number. Keep the calculations separate and understand what each measurement represents.

Both measurements matter, but they tell you different things. Cannabinoid percentages indicate potency, while terpene percentages indicate aroma, flavor, and potentially the character of the effect. A high-THC strain with low terpenes will smell and taste different from a strain with the same THC level but higher terpene content.

Practical Tips for Reading Your Lab Report

Start by checking which terpenes are present rather than focusing only on the total percentage. Common terpenes include myrcene, limonene, caryophyllene, pinene, linalool, and humulene. Each has a distinct aroma and potential effects.

Look at the ratio between terpenes, not just the total. A product with equal parts myrcene and limonene will feel different from one dominated by myrcene alone. The ratios influence the overall character of the product.

If the lab report lists terpenes in both percentage and milligrams per gram, use the percentage values for easy comparison. If only mg/g is listed, convert using the formula mentioned earlier: divide by 10 to get the percentage.

Finally, remember that lab results are a tool, not a guarantee. They give you useful information about what is in the product, but individual responses to cannabis vary widely. Use the terpene data to guide your choices, not to predict a specific outcome.

Frequently Asked Questions

How do I calculate total terpene percentage from a lab report?

Add together the percentages of every individual terpene listed in the lab report. The sum is the total terpene percentage.

What is the formula for converting mg/g to terpene percentage?

Divide the mg/g value by 10 to get the percentage. For example, 15 mg/g equals 1.5%.

What is a high terpene percentage in cannabis flower?

Flower testing above 2% total terpenes is generally considered high. Most flower falls between 0.5% and 3%.

Why do terpene percentages differ between labs?

Different testing methods, equipment calibration, sample handling, and moisture content all affect results. Compare products using reports from the same lab when possible.
